Creating Value Propositions

When engaging in telesales, the importance of creating strong value propositions cannot be overstated. This element forms the foundation upon which a successful client relationship is built. It involves meticulously crafting a clear and compelling case for the products or services being offered, emphasising the unique benefits and advantages that the client will gain by choosing to work with the company. Tailoring solutions to meet client objectives

To effectively engage clients in a telesales setting, it is crucial to tailor solutions to meet their specific objectives. By actively listening to the client's needs and preferences during conversations, sales representatives can better understand how to align their product or service offerings with the client's desired outcomes. This personalised approach not only demonstrates a genuine interest in the client's success but also helps build trust and rapport, laying a solid foundation for a long-term business relationship.

By customising solutions to meet client objectives, telesales professionals can provide targeted recommendations that address the unique challenges and goals of each individual client. This bespoke approach shows that the sales representative values the client's input and is committed to delivering solutions that are truly beneficial. As a result, clients are more likely to feel understood and respected, increasing their satisfaction with the sales process and enhancing the overall effectiveness of the telesales interaction.

How to Implement Effective Communication Strategies in TelesalesTo enhance the customer experience and promote long-term retention, personalizing communication and follow-up within outsourced telesales is paramount. By addressing clients by name and referencing previous interactions, agents can build rapport and establish a more personalised relationship. This approach creates a sense of trust and familiarity, making customers more likely to engage positively with the sales process.
Furthermore, following up on leads and communication in a timely manner is crucial for maintaining momentum and preventing potential leads from going cold. Implementing a structured follow-up system ensures that no opportunity is missed and that customers feel valued and attended to. By tailoring follow-up strategies to each client's preferences and needs, outsourced telesales can significantly improve conversion rates and overall customer satisfaction.
